What is ProPetro Holding Corp.'s hydraulic fracturing — cost of service - expendables?
ProPetro Holding Corp. (PUMP) reported hydraulic fracturing — cost of service - expendables of $27.89M in Q1 2026.
How has ProPetro Holding Corp.'s hydraulic fracturing — cost of service - expendables changed year-over-year?
ProPetro Holding Corp.'s hydraulic fracturing — cost of service - expendables decreased by 36.8% year-over-year, from $44.15M to $27.89M.
What is the long-term trend for ProPetro Holding Corp.'s hydraulic fracturing — cost of service - expendables?
Over 3 years (2022 to 2025), ProPetro Holding Corp.'s hydraulic fracturing — cost of service - expendables has grown at a -17.6%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$246.56M to $137.92M.
What does hydraulic fracturing — cost of service - expendables mean?
This represents the costs of consumable materials and parts required to perform fracturing operations, such as proppant handling components or specialized seals. It is a key variable cost that fluctuates based on activity levels and supply chain pricing.
